Dial-A-Star
With her partnership with Dial-A-Star, Farrah could charge fans $5 per minute to talk to her on the phone. Starcasm reports that she made $800 a month for these chats with fans.
Adult Actor
In May of 2013, Farrah’s so-called “s*x tape” was released, which she co-starred in with James Deen. Although it was initially reported that Farrah made a whopping $1.5 million from the sale, later reports revealed that she actually only made $10,000 plus 30% of sales after production costs.
